Heartflow is a medical technology company advancing the diagnosis and management of coronary artery disease, the #1 cause of death worldwide, using cutting-edge technology. The flagship product—an AI-driven, non-invasive cardiac test supported by the ACC/AHA Chest Pain Guidelines called the Heartflow FFRCT Analysis—provides a color-coded, 3D model of a patient’s coronary arteries indicating the impact blockages have on blood flow to the heart. Heartflow is the first AI-driven non-invasive integrated heart care solution across the CCTA pathway that helps clinicians identify stenoses in the coronary arteries (RoadMap™Analysis), assess coronary blood flow (FFRCT Analysis), and characterize and quantify coronary atherosclerosis (Plaque Analysis). The individual will be responsible for the identification, development, and management of strategic relationships with payers and organizations that influence payer decision-making within their assigned geographic region. The person will work directly with the Market Access team including the sales, implementation, and billing specialist teams within their respective regions and will serve as a resource for identification and resolution of payer related issues. The person will be responsible for regional managed care organizations within their assigned geography. This person will also interact within a broader Market Access team and ultimately be responsible for implementation of tactical plan developed by the market access leadership team. In addition, this position will provide critical competitive intelligence within the market access marketplace to leadership. The individual will assist in the development of the local market access strategic plan for Heartflow’s FFRCT­ Analysis. The ultimate goal of the position is to minimize FFRCT access barriers and to achieve favorable coverage policy and reimbursement contracts for Heartflow products with commercial payers as well as support other billing and collections projects as needed. #LI-IB1; #LI-Remote Job Responsibilities: Assume and implement assigned projects to increase covered lives and revenue.
